Why do you charge admission?
Our model is that hosts charge audience members a modest fee to watch the films in each house. For example, in Seattle, it was $5 per house. Why do we do this? One is, honestly, we were always worried that if the festival were free it would make hosts nervous that anyone and everyone could just walk right into their house--people who were maybe just bored and had no real understanding of the love of film, community or the idea behind the festival. By charging around$5, it hopefully gives the host houses a little bit of assurance that people who are coming are willing to pay, want to be there, and want to see the films and do understand the idea behind the event.
Hopefully our humble approach still fits with your vision.

Where will the films come from?
We have spent too many months in the dark attending many of the most respectable film festivals in the world to bring the very best films. We also receive films from around the world and only accept the very best. We do this because if you have crappy films, you have a crappy film festival. We would get into a dirty school-yard fight defending every single film that we accept for our festival. Here is a list of some of the film festivals we attend to find films that we like: SXSW, SF Shorts, CFC Worldwide Shorts, Seattle International Film Festival, Melbourne International Film Festival, International Random Film Festival, and the New Horizon Film Festival.How will I receive the films to play at my house?
